بایگانی

نوشته های برچسب زده شده ‘unix’

زمان های ثانیه ای

نمدونم تا حالا ساعت های با نوع عددی مثل ۱۲۶۸۷۸۳۳۷۸ رو دیدید؟

این عدد نمایانگر روز و ساعت و دقیقه (کلا تاریخ کامل) هست.

مثلا این عدد با timeZone گرینویچ میشه: Tue, 16 Mar 2010 23:49:38 GMT

به همین دقیقی :D

به این نوع از زمان ، زمان ایپوخ (epoch) میگن که در سیستم عامل لینوکس از این نوع ساعت استفاده میشه که البته به اون unix timestamp هم میگن.

این عدد بر اساس ثانیه هست، یعنی زمانی که برمیگردونه بر اساس ضرب سال و ماه و روز و دقیقه و ساعت و ثانیه بر اعدادی هست که میرسونه اونا رو به ثانیه!

ادامه ی نوشته

راحت در ترمینال توییت کنید

این پست برای لینوکس/مکینتاش کارهای عزیز هست

الان از توی ترمینال کلی کار ها رو میشه انجام داد ولی این یکیش رو خودتون خیلی ساده مینوسین ;)

میخوام توی این پست به شما با یه قطعه کد یاد بدم که چطوری از توی terminal/bash لینوکس یا مکینتاش میتونید توییت کنید

اصل ماجرا این دستور هست:

 curl -u pilevar:***** -d status="salam, in tweet e man hast!" http://168.143.171.180/statuses/update.xml

که این دستور میره و نام کاربری و پسورد شما رو که در اینجا به ترتیب: pilevar و ***** هست رو به همراه post یک متغیر به نام status به نشانی http://168.143.171.180/statuses/update.xml میفرستد و چون در ایران با دمکراسی شبکه خائن و شایعه پراکن توییتر(!) فیلتر شده از IP اون برای ارتباط استفاده شده است! مسلما این دستور زیادی زیاد هست و ارزشی نداره برای یه توییتر اینقدر چرتو پرتا رو بنویسین حالا برای اینکه این دستور رو کمش کنیم و یه جورایی Script اش کنیم به روش زیر عمل میکنیم:
ادامه ی نوشته